cloudy
简明释义
adj. 多云的,阴天的;浑浊的,不清澈的;含糊的,困惑的;(眼睛)泪眼蒙眬的;愁容满面的
比 较 级 c l o u d i e r 或 m o r e c l o u d y
最 高 级 c l o u d i e s t 或 m o s t c l o u d y
英英释义
Covered with or characterized by clouds; not clear or bright. | 被云覆盖的;没有清晰或明亮的。 |
外观阴沉或多云;缺乏亮度。 |

The weather can greatly influence our mood and daily activities. On days when the sky is cloudy, many people tend to feel a bit more lethargic and less motivated. The term cloudy refers to a sky that is covered with clouds, blocking the sunlight and often leading to a dimmer atmosphere. This kind of weather can evoke a sense of calmness or even melancholy, depending on one’s perspective.For instance, I remember a particular Saturday when I had planned a picnic with friends. We were all excited about spending the day outdoors, enjoying the sunshine and the warmth of the season. However, as the day approached, the forecast predicted a cloudy sky. Despite our hopes for a clear day, we decided to go ahead with our plans. When we arrived at the park, the sky was indeed cloudy, and the lack of sunlight made the surroundings appear duller than usual.Even though the day was cloudy, we tried to make the best of it. We set up our picnic blanket under a large tree, which provided some shelter from the cool breeze. As we shared food and laughter, I realized that the cloudy weather did not define our experience. Instead, it brought a unique charm to the day. The soft light created by the clouds made everything look more serene, and we were able to focus more on our conversations without the distractions of bright sunlight.However, cloudy days can also have their downsides. For some individuals, prolonged periods of cloudy weather can lead to feelings of sadness or depression. This phenomenon is often referred to as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D), where the lack of sunlight affects one's mood and energy levels. It is important to find ways to cope during these times, such as engaging in indoor activities, exercising, or even using light therapy to mimic sunlight.In contrast, there are others who find comfort in cloudy days. The overcast sky can be a perfect backdrop for reading a book, watching movies, or simply enjoying a cup of tea at home. The absence of harsh sunlight can make it easier to relax and unwind. Personally, I enjoy cloudy days for this very reason. They provide an opportunity to slow down and appreciate the quieter moments in life.Moreover, cloudy weather can also be beneficial for nature. Plants and flowers thrive in cooler temperatures, and the moisture from the clouds can help nourish the earth. Farmers often welcome cloudy days as they prepare their crops, knowing that the rain may soon follow. Therefore, while we may sometimes wish for sunnier skies, it is essential to recognize the value that cloudy days bring to our environment.In conclusion, the word cloudy encompasses more than just a description of the weather. It reflects how we perceive our surroundings and how we adapt to different situations. Whether we choose to embrace the tranquility of a cloudy day or seek out the sun, each type of weather has its own beauty and significance. Next time you find yourself under a cloudy sky, take a moment to appreciate the unique atmosphere it creates and the opportunities it presents for reflection and connection with others.
